James Hall Pam Sammons Rebecca Smees Kathy Sylva Maria Evangelou Jenny Goff 《牛津教育评论》2019,45(3):367-389
UK Sure Start Children’s Centres (SSCCs) aim to lessen behavioural disorders yet we lack evidence concerning how this is achieved. This study evaluates one possible mechanism: improved home learning environments (HLEs). Data come from a longitudinal study of 2568 families and children recruited at a mean age of 14 months from 117 SSCCs in England in 2012. Behavioural disorders were measured at 38 months via the Strengths and Difficulties Questionnaire. HLEs were measured at 14 and 38 months via parental interview. Families’ use of SSCCs was measured via parental interview at 14, 22, and 38 months. This study suggests that the use of SSCCs is associated with fewer preschool behavioural disorders via intermediate changes to the quality of HLE’s. Implications are discussed for social policies and for early years’ professionals. 相似文献

This article reports on a case study of one New Zealand university faculty involved in the second phase of a three-phase study investigating the experiences of talented undergraduate students. Talented undergraduate students are a largely forgotten group in research. The current study sought to investigate who the talented students were, and then what their lived experiences as talented undergraduate students were. The study involved 128 undergraduate students who provided information about their experiences as high achieving students in an undergraduate degree program. Approximately 10% of all students enrolled across five different undergraduate degree programs in the faculty were defined as talented undergraduate students. These students were ethnically diverse and largely older than we had anticipated. The majority had not previously been identified as talented and many had been largely unsuccessful educationally, prior to embarking on their undergraduate studies. Several students experienced challenging personal circumstances, such as financial hardship and extensive family responsibilities. The grit or resilience demonstrated by these students seemed to explain the essence of the phenomenon of being a talented undergraduate student in this faculty. 相似文献

William R. Penuel Philip Bell Bronwyn Bevan Pam Buffington Joni Falk 《Journal of Educational Change》2016,17(2):251-278
This paper explores practical ways to engage two areas of educational scholarship—research on science learning and research on social networks—to inform efforts to plan and support implementation of new standards. The standards, the Next Generation Science Standards (NGSS; NGSS Lead States in Next generation science standards: For states, by states. National Academies Press, Washington, DC, 2013), have been adopted by U.S. states serving more than one-quarter of all students, and they are grounded in decades of research on how students learn science. In this paper we discuss efforts to leverage recent research on social networks to inform standards implementation across a set of professional associations and school districts. These efforts are being undertaken by the Research + Practice Collaboratory which is testing a set of conjectures related to how the knowledge base from both research and practice can mutually inform STEM education improvement. 相似文献

Pam Sammons Christopher Day Alison Kington Qing Gu Gordon Stobart Rebecca Smees 《British Educational Research Journal》2007,33(5):681-701
This article outlines the research design of a large‐scale, longitudinal research study in England intended to describe and explore variations in teachers' work, lives and their effects on pupils' educational outcomes. The study, funded by the Department for Education and Skills (DfES) and incorporated into the Teaching and Learning Research Programme (TLRP) as an ‘Associate Project’, used an innovative mixed‐methods research design to create case studies of 300 teachers in Years 2, 6 and 9. The research was conducted over three consecutive academic years and collected a wide range of data through interviews, questionnaire surveys of teachers' and pupils' views and assessment data on pupils' attainments in English and mathematics. The text summarises the main findings from the research in relation to four interconnected themes of the study: Professional Life Phases; Professional Identity; Relative Effectiveness; and Resilience and Commitment. The influence of school context, in terms of level of social disadvantage of pupil intake, is also investigated. Key findings and their implications for policy and practice are highlighted. 相似文献

Alexis Patterson Diego Roman Michelle Friend Jonathan Osborne Brian Donovan 《International Journal of Science Education》2018,40(3):291-307
Reading is fundamental to science and not an adjunct to its practice. In other words, understanding the meaning of the various forms of written discourse employed in the creation, discussion, and communication of scientific knowledge is inherent to how science works. The language used in science, however, sets up a barrier, that in order to be overcome requires all students to have a clear understanding of the features of the multimodal informational texts employed in science and the strategies they can use to decode the scientific concepts communicated in informational texts. We argue that all teachers of science must develop a functional understanding of reading comprehension as part of their professional knowledge and skill. After describing our rationale for including knowledge about reading as a professional knowledge base every teacher of science should have, we outline the knowledge about language teachers must develop, the knowledge about the challenges that reading comprehension of science texts poses for students, and the knowledge about instructional strategies science teachers should know to support their students’ reading comprehension of science texts. Implications regarding the essential role that knowledge about reading should play in the preparation of science teachers are also discussed here. 相似文献

This study describes the development and validation of a science and engineering (S/E) career interest survey (CIS). This 56 question survey was developed to measure the overall S/E career interests of 7th through 9th grade students. In the CIS, a S/E career is characterized as one which requires the completion of at least a four-year college program with a major in science, science education, or engineering. The CIS is divided into four major parts. In Part I (30 questions), students are expected to select from occupational activities, while in Part II (20 questions) they are to select from various occupations. Part III (5 questions) and Part IV together make up the CIS internal verification scale. The CIS test-retest reliability coefficients for one week and eight months were calculated as 0.96 (n = 57, grades 7–9) and 0.78 (n = 1937, grade 8), respectively. The KR-21 estimate for the CIS was calculated as 0.92. Criterion-related validity coefficients were calculated in two ways: (a) CIS scores were correlated with the Kuder GIS science subscale (r = 0.75, n = 45, grades 7–9), and (b) CIS scores were correlated with a CIS internal verification scale (r = 0.59, n = 127, grades 7–9). Evidence to support the construct validity of the CIS was collected by two methods: (a) for 7–9 grade students (n = 45), the CIS score was found to correlate 0.75 with the scientific subscale and ?0.42 with the artistic sub-scale, of the Kuder GIS. (b) the second method compared the scores of known groups. Test results for students in grades 7-9 (n = 127; n = 1937) showed a statistically significant difference between the scores of boys and girls on S/E career interest. The readability of the CIS was seventh grade level. 相似文献

Richard White Dr. Richard Gunstone Enno Elterman Ian Macdonald Brian McKittrick David Mills Pam Mulhall 《Research in Science Education》1995,25(4):465-478
The transition from school to university involves substantial change in the structure and organization of teaching, and in
the nature and purpose of learning contexts. This paper, which reports some data from a broader study of learning and teaching
in first year university physics, focuses on aspects of the school-university transition. In particular, we report perceptions
of first year physics students about how they should learn physics, what it is intended they should learn, and what they believe
to be the functions of the various teaching situations in which they are placed. 相似文献

Peter Mortimore Pam Sammons Sally Thomas 《Assessment in Education: Principles, Policy & Practice》1994,1(3):315-332
The theory that schools can promote the progress of pupils so as to overcome the influence of family, community and individual attributes, underpins British studies of school effectiveness. Measures of value added have been developed as sophisticated ways of analysing potential school effects. Desmond Nuttall played a key role in adapting the statistical technique of multilevel modelling to the issue of value added. In this paper we provide a general introduction to three topics and describe three, as yet, unresolved issues: whether value added results are stable over time; whether schools have differential results for different pupil groups; and whether the contextual features of a school exert a powerful influence on its performance. 相似文献

Learning from curriculum materials: Scaffolds for new teachers? 总被引:1,自引:0,他引:1
This article explores how beginning teachers use and learn from curriculum materials. As part of a longitudinal study of beginning English teachers who teach in the Pacific Northwest of the United States, the researchers tracked teachers’ responses to and use of materials over time, and how these materials shaped their classroom practice. The authors found that the teachers spent an enormous amount of time searching out curriculum materials for their classes and that the curriculum materials they encountered did, indeed, powerfully shape their ideas about teaching language arts as well as their classroom practice. Based on their findings, the authors propose a trajectory for the teachers’ use of the curriculum materials. New teachers begin by sticking close to the materials they have at hand. Then, over time, as they learn more about both students and curriculum, they adapt and adjust their use of the materials. The authors argue that new and aspiring teachers need opportunities to analyze and critique curriculum materials, beginning during teacher education and continuing in the company of their more experienced colleagues. 相似文献

Spaces of influence: A framework for analysis of an individual’s contribution within communities of practice 总被引:1,自引:0,他引:1
Pam Green 《高等教育研究与发展》2005,24(4):293-307
Within our lives there are spaces of influence or opportunities in which the impact of an ‘influential other’ enables learning in ways that might not otherwise occur. This paper focusses on learning in terms of the learning of others, and in particular the professional impact of John Bowden. Building on the work of Vygotsky (1978), and Wood, Bruner and Ross (1976), the notion of supported learning is revisited and extended. A range of actual stories involving Bowden as key influence are presented through which the term: spaces of influence is developed. The stories flow from varied contexts including those pertaining to research students, communities of practice around methodological positions steeped in qualitative methods, phenomenography, and a scholarly review network. Five spaces within a metaspace of influence‐action, explicit discourse, learning, practice development and trust are developed through the analysis of the stories. The paper pays tribute to the significant work of John Bowden, through the telling of embedded stories, the interweaving of theory such as Bowden and Marton’s (1998) theory of learning for an unknown future, and through the development of the notion of spaces of influence that emerged from reflection here on Bowden’s contribution within communities of practice. 相似文献
